#567264 Hex color

#567264

The hexadecimal color code #567264 corresponds to the code RGB( 86, 114, 100 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,34 level), green (at 0,45 level) and blue (at 0,39 level). Its brightness is 39% and its saturation is 14%. It is composed of red at 28%, green at 38% and blue at 33%.
